Q: Is 67,915 a Prime Number?

 A: No, 67,915 is not a prime number.

Why is 67,915 not a prime number?

A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.

The number 67915 can be evenly divided by 1 5 17 47 85 235 289 799 1,445 3,995 13,583 and 67,915, with no remainder.

Since 67,915 cannot be divided by just 1 and 67,915, it is not a prime number.
